    Description

    Textra is word game, that consist of a plastic container, 206 letter tiles and 4 letter trays - clearly inspired by Scrabble, but the main gimmick here is the plastic container with clever mechanism to separate vowels and consonants. In the container you have trail where you put your letter tiles to make words. And when the trail is full (something like 15 tiles), the first used letters drop in to two departments one for vowels and other for consonants.

    When you start the game, the first player puts one vowel and one consonant in any order in to the trail and then every player gets six letter tiles to make words. You can choose the distribution of vowels and consonants at the start of the game and always when you refill your tile tray. At the players turn you try to make a word using as many already laid letters in a trail as the first letters of your new word. Rest of your word consists of letters you have in your tray. You just put the letters from your tray to the trail to make a new word. Then you multiply newly added letters with letters you used from the previous ones and that makes your points. You fill your hand and then it is the next players turn.

    Example: "AUTO" becomes "autoMATIC" (4*5=20 pts.), then "ticK" (3*1), then "tickLE" (4*2) etc.

    In a four player game you play to the end of the round, when someone gets total of 60 points. Winner is the player who got the most points. In three player game you play until 80 points and with two players until 100 points. When playing alone you just decide number of rounds and try to make as many points as as you can.

    You can play this game as long as you like, because the used letters are dropping back to containers departments, which is the same place where you take the new letter tiles. There is 100 vowel tiles and 100 consonant tiles and six wild tiles in the game. There's quite a few letters missing, that are used in Finnish language. Letter distribution of the game is: vowels: (40*A, 10*E, 20*I 15*O, 15*U) and consonants: (5*H, 5*J, 15*K, 15*L, 5*M, 10*N, 5*P, 5*R, 10*S, 20*T, 5*V). You can play the game in any language, where you can make enough words with these letters. Because of "the clever" mechanism, the vowel tiles are bit smaller than the consonant tiles.
